Hi Sellers!

We asked for winning strategies in our Spring Sweepstakes, and you delivered! Whether you're a seasoned pro or just starting out, these top tips from sellers like you can help you thrive this spring and beyond. Let's dive into the first 5 themes we saw throughout the event.

1. Master the FBA-FBM Balance

Many successful sellers utilize a strategic combination of Fulfillment by Amazon (FBA) and Fulfillment by Merchant (FBM) options to optimize their operations. Understanding when to leverage each fulfillment method can be beneficial for sellers looking to maximize efficiency and profitability.

💬 Seller Insight: "Do not FBA everything. Wait to see what sells well via FBM and only FBA those items that sell well."

Key Takeaways:

  • Consider testing new products with FBM, and moving best-sellers to FBA
  • Consider maintaining flexibility with multiple fulfillment options
  • Choose the best option based on your specific items and business needs

📚 Resources for you:

2. Plan Ahead for Seasonal Success

Smart seasonal planning can make or break your Q2 performance. Start early and think regionally.

💬 Seller Insights: "Spring happens in phases across the country. May want to adjust shipping templates accordingly depending on where you are."...."Lead Time Buffer: Ship spring‑critical SKUs early so stock lands by March. Safety Stock: Increase buffer to 45–60 days for top spring sellers."

Key Takeaways:

  • Begin preparations 2-3 months in advance
  • Account for regional climate differences
  • Create a buffer for extended FBA receiving times (up to 6-8 weeks)

📚 Resources for you:

3. Boost Visibility with Strategic Marketing

Great products need great visibility. Optimize your listings and advertising for maximum impact.

💬 Seller Insight: "I've learned that even the best product won't sell if no one sees it. What I wish I knew early is how important ad strategy is."

Key Takeaways:

  • Invest time in optimizing listings with strong images and keywords
  • Use PPC (Pay-Per-Click) advertising strategically and monitor costs carefully
  • Take advantage of promotional opportunities and focus on building brand presence

📚 Resources for you:

4. Grow Smartly and Sustainably

Avoid overextending by starting small and scaling based on real data.

💬 Seller Insight: "As a newcomer, go slow, don't invest too much into the platform. Start with small M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ity), see what sells, keep the flow going of that product."

Key Takeaways:

  • Test products with minimal inventory at first
  • Use sales data to guide expansion
  • Learn from small mistakes to avoid big ones

📚 Resources for you:

5. Master Your Financials

Understanding and controlling your costs is crucial for long-term success.

💬 Seller Insights: "Know your numbers when it comes to running ads. Aim for TACOS (ad spend divided by revenue) of less than 10% as a rough rule of thumb."..."Watch your margins. It's easy to get excited by sales and forget about fees, shipping, returns, and ads. Keep a simple spreadsheet or system to make sure you're not losing money on what looks like a 'win.'"

Key Takeaways:

  • Calculate all fees before listing (storage, advertising, shipping)
  • Monitor and optimize advertising spend
  • Regularly review and adjust pricing strategies

Some items I sell, need about 50-100 available via FBA at all times. I have about 300-500 in my own small shop. So I plan on sending all 300-500 into AWD, and they will feed FBA on an As Needed, basis. I sell about 100 of these per month.

But, what about products that I have a small amount of? Some ASIN's I only move 10 or 20 per month, so my plan is usually to send those 10 or 20, each month, into FBA.

Instead, should I be sending those low volume items into AWD also?

Basically, when should I decide whether or not to send an ASIN into FBA vs AWD?

Hello,

To improve the accuracy of weight and dimension inputs for domestic US Amazon Partnered Carrier shipments, notifications in Seller Central inform you when carriers find differences between the measurements that you enter and your shipment's actual measurements.

If the measured weight, dimensions, or freight class (when applicable) of your small parcel or less-than-truckload shipment differs from what you provided at shipment creation, you see a notification in the Inbound Performance dashboard.

Starting on June 12, 2025, these measurement differences will result in a fee adjustment including a credit to your account if your provided measurements were too high or a charge if they were too low.

You can view your measurement differences by following these steps:

Go to the Inbound Performance dashboard.

Select Inaccurate transportation weight/dims under Defect group.

Click View details to see the specific measurement difference.

Listing Suspension Catch 22
by Seller_yzZ8Bn2WKfDj3
Amazon replied

We’re stuck, our listing has been suspended because four customers claimed that it didn’t work.

Account health are telling us that we need to update the listing in order to get it out of its suspension.

Seller support are telling us they can’t change it untill the listing is out of its suspension.

Flat files are throwing up an unspecified error.

Brand registry are saying they can’t do anything because there’s an active appeal.

This has been going on for the best part of a month, we’re losing close to a thousand dollars a day in profit and will struggle to pay staff this month.

We were able to take the impact of tariffs on the chin, but with this sucker punch from the inside we’re not sure if we’ll survive. Losing hair trying to get it fixed, but it feels like we’re banging heads against a wall.
